Synopsis
In the latest chapter of Laid-Back Camp, the Outdoor Exploration Club welcomes a new face—Mei, who eagerly joins her friends on an exciting camping adventure to Karisaka in Yamanashi. Aoi and Mei set off on their bicycles, embracing the thrill of the ride, while Chiaki and Toba-sensei opt for the convenience of a car journey.
Meanwhile, Rin has her own unique plans, choosing to embark on a solo trip to Saitama. As the group navigates their individual paths, the beauty of nature and the joys of camaraderie unfold, highlighting the serene yet lively spirit of camping together in the great outdoors.
Otaku Consensus
Because Laid-Back Camp Season 4 has not aired, there is no credible post-release critical consensus yet; the current verdict is a pre-release one built on staff, studio, and source-position signals. Its strongest case is continuity of tone through Shin Tosaka's direction, Pierre Sugiura's series composition, Akiyuki Tateyama's music, and the announced Karisaka/Saitama travel split, while the real caveat is that FuRyu Pictures' execution and the season's pacing cannot be judged until episodes screen.

What Makes It Stand Out
- 1
FuRyu Pictures is the listed studio for this 2027 season, making the new installment a key test of how the franchise's soft slice-of-life identity translates under its current production banner.
- 2
The staff list emphasizes tone control: Shin Tosaka directs, Pierre Sugiura handles series composition, Takeshi Takadera supervises sound, and Akiyuki Tateyama returns as the named composer for the season's travel-and-camp atmosphere.
- 3
Asaka is credited for the opening theme and Eri Sasaki for the ending theme, a pairing that directly targets one of the franchise's strongest rituals: easing viewers into and out of each episode with recognizable acoustic warmth.
- 4
The announced structure separates outdoor activity by mode of travel, with cycling, car travel, and solo touring all present; that gives the season multiple rhythms instead of relying on a single group-camp format.
